Comparaison des endpoints Retweets de X API
| Description | Standard v1.1 | X API v2 |
|---|---|---|
| Méthodes HTTP prises en charge | GET | GET |
| Domaine d’hébergement | https://api.x.com | https://api.x.com |
| Chemin d’endpoint | /1.1/retweeters/id.json/1.1/retweets/ids.json | /2/users/:id/retweeted_by |
| Authentification | Contexte utilisateur OAuth 1.0a | Jeton Bearer OAuth 2.0 Contexte utilisateur OAuth 1.0a |
| Limites de taux de requêtes par défaut (limites de taux) | 75 requêtes par 15 min | 75 requêtes par 15 min (par App) 75 requêtes par 15 min (par utilisateur) |
| Format des données | Format standard v1.1 | Format X API v2 (déterminé par les paramètres de requête fields et expansions, non rétrocompatible avec les formats v1.1) Pour en savoir plus sur la migration du format standard v1.1 vers le format X API v2, veuillez consulter notre guide de migration des formats de données. |
| Nécessite l’utilisation d’identifiants provenant d’une App développeur associée à un Project | ✔️ |
Gérer les Retweets
| Description | Standard v1.1 | X API v2 |
|---|---|---|
| Méthodes HTTP prises en charge | POST | POST |
| Domaine d’hébergement | https://api.x.com | https://api.x.com |
| Chemin d’endpoint | /1.1/statuses/retweet/:id.json | /2/users/:id/retweets |
| Authentication | Contexte utilisateur OAuth 1.0a | Contexte utilisateur OAuth 1.0a |
| Limites de taux de requêtes par défaut | Aucune 300 requêtes par fenêtre de 3 heures (par utilisateur, par App). Ceci est partagé avec l’endpoint POST Tweet | 50 requêtes par 15 minutes (par utilisateur) 300 requêtes par fenêtre de 3 heures (par utilisateur, par App). Ceci est partagé avec l’endpoint POST Tweet pour gérer les Publications. |
| Nécessite l’utilisation d’identifiants d’une developer App associée à un Project | ✔️ |
Annuler un Retweet
| Description | Standard v1.1 | X API v2 |
|---|---|---|
| Méthodes HTTP prises en charge | POST | DELETE |
| Domaine hôte | https://api.x.com | https://api.x.com |
| Chemin d’endpoint | /1.1/statuses/unretweet/:id.json | /2/users/:id/retweets/:source_tweet_id |
| Authentification | OAuth 1.0a User Context | OAuth 1.0a User Context |
| Limites de taux de requêtes par défaut | Aucune | 50 requêtes toutes les 15 min (par utilisateur) |
| Nécessite l’utilisation d’identifiants issus d’une App développeur associée à un Project | ✔️ |